About This Item
New York: Harper & Row, 1966. First Edition. Hardcover. Near Fine/Near Fine. Black cloth. Near fine in like dust jacket. With the bookplate of Douglas Fairbanks, Jr. on the front pastedown. Inscribed on the front free endpaper: "Warmly to Doulas & Mary Lee Fairbanks, of the truly valued / John / NY / 1967.
